Current research projects:

Restitution of the Carpathian population of the European bison

Program includes: population studies (numbers, dynamics, and population structure), genetic monitoring, and assessments of spatial distribution and habitat preferences. The goal of the program is the establishment of a stable meta-population and the network of bison refuges in the Carpathians, through the extension of the home range of present free-ranging population of the species and introductions. The program is conducted in co-operation with Slovak, Romanian, Hungarian, and Ukrainian partners. In Polish part of the range, the focus of the program is the establishment and verification of bison refuges under the framework of Natura 2000 network.
